What Are Warehouse Trolleys And How Do They Work?
Warehouse trolleys are wheeled devices designed to transport goods, materials, and products within industrial and commercial spaces. They work on a straightforward principle: reduce the physical effort needed to move items from point A to point B.
Types of Warehouse Trolleys Explained
The market offers an impressive variety of trolley styles, each suited to specific tasks. Platform trolleys feature flat surfaces perfect for stacking boxes and general cargo. Cage trolleys come with mesh sides that keep items secure during transport. Hand trolleys, often called sack trucks, excel at moving tall or cylindrical items like drums and appliances.
Roll containers and stock trolleys are particularly popular in retail environments. They allow staff to wheel merchandise directly onto the shop floor, streamlining restocking processes considerably.
Key Features To Look For In Quality Trolleys
When shopping for warehouse trolleys, pay attention to wheel quality first. Swivel castors offer manoeuvrability, while fixed wheels provide stability. The frame material matters too—steel offers durability, whilst aluminium provides lightweight handling.
Look for ergonomic handles positioned at comfortable heights. Brake systems are essential for safety, especially on sloped surfaces. A good trolley should feel sturdy without being unnecessarily heavy to push.
Top Benefits Of Using Warehouse Trolleys
Improved Workplace Efficiency And Productivity
Time is money in any warehouse environment. Trolleys allow workers to move larger quantities of goods in fewer trips, dramatically cutting down on wasted movement. A single platform trolley can carry what might otherwise require four or five manual trips.
This efficiency boost compounds throughout the day. Workers spend less energy on transport and more on value-adding tasks. The result? Higher productivity levels and faster order fulfilment times that keep customers happy.
Reduced Risk Of Workplace Injuries
Manual handling injuries cost Australian businesses millions annually. Back strains, muscle pulls, and repetitive stress injuries are all too common in warehouses where staff lift and carry heavy loads repeatedly.
Trolleys shift this burden from human bodies to wheels and frames. Workers can push rather than lift, using their body weight instead of straining muscles. This simple change reduces injury rates significantly and keeps your team healthy and present.
Better Organisation and Space Management
Quality trolleys contribute to tidier, more organised workspaces. Stock trolleys and roll containers can serve as temporary storage, keeping aisles clear while goods await processing.
Many businesses use colour-coded trolleys to separate different product categories or workflow stages. This visual management system speeds up operations and reduces errors during picking and packing.
Versatility Across Industries
Warehouse trolleys aren't limited to warehouses alone. They prove invaluable in hospitals transporting medical supplies, hotels moving laundry, and restaurants shifting heavy deliveries. Their adaptability makes them a smart investment for practically any business that moves goods.
How Do Warehouse Trolleys Improve Safety In The Workplace?
Ergonomic Design And Manual Handling Compliance
Modern trolleys incorporate ergonomic principles that protect workers' bodies. Handle heights are calculated to minimise reaching and bending. Push forces are engineered to stay within safe limits for extended use.
These design features help businesses comply with manual handling regulations. Using appropriate equipment demonstrates a commitment to worker welfare and reduces the risk of regulatory penalties.
Meeting Australian Workplace Health And Safety Standards
Safe Work Australia sets clear guidelines for manual handling in workplaces. Providing suitable mechanical aids like trolleys is a fundamental requirement for businesses managing physical work tasks.
Using trolleys shows due diligence in your risk management approach. Should an incident occur, having proper equipment in place demonstrates you've taken reasonable steps to protect your staff.
What Types Of Trolleys Are Best For Warehouse Use?
Platform Trolleys
These flat-bed workhorses handle the widest variety of loads. They're brilliant for moving multiple boxes, awkward shapes, or mixed consignments. Most feature fold-down handles for compact storage.
Cage Trolleys
When security matters, cage trolleys shine. Their mesh sides prevent items from falling during transport, making them ideal for loose goods or uneven loads. They're particularly popular in retail distribution.
Hand Trolleys and Sack Trucks
For tall items like fridges, water coolers, or stacked boxes, hand trolleys are unbeatable. Their vertical design and tilting action make light work of heavy, bulky objects that would be awkward on flat platforms.
Roll Containers And Stock Trolleys
Retail operations love roll containers for their dual functionality. They transport goods efficiently and then serve as display units on the shop floor, eliminating the need to unpack and restock separately.
Are Warehouse Trolleys Worth The Investment?
Calculating Return On Investment
Consider the time savings first. If trolleys save each worker just fifteen minutes daily, that adds up to over sixty hours annually per employee. Multiply that by your wage costs and the numbers become compelling quickly.
Factor in reduced injury costs, lower product damage rates, and improved staff morale. Most businesses see their trolley investment returned within months, not years.
Long-Term Durability And Maintenance Considerations
Quality trolleys last for years with minimal maintenance. Regular wheel checks, occasional lubrication, and prompt repairs when needed keep them rolling smoothly. Compared to powered equipment, maintenance costs are negligible.
How To Choose the Right Warehouse Trolley for Your Business
Assessing Load Capacity Requirements
Start by identifying your heaviest typical loads. Choose trolleys rated comfortably above this weight—working at maximum capacity constantly shortens equipment lifespan and increases accident risk.
Considering Your Warehouse Layout and Floor Type
Narrow aisles need nimble trolleys with tight turning circles. Smooth concrete suits smaller wheels, while rough surfaces require larger, more robust castors. Match your trolley choice to your specific environment.
Matching Trolleys To Specific Tasks
Different operations need different solutions. Order picking might benefit from multi-tier trolleys. Heavy manufacturing requires industrial-strength platforms. Take time to analyse your workflows before purchasing.
Common Industries That Benefit from Warehouse Trolleys
Retail And Distribution Centres
From backroom to shop floor, trolleys keep retail moving. They speed up deliveries, simplify restocking, and help manage seasonal stock surges efficiently.
Manufacturing And Production Facilities
Production lines depend on steady material flow. Trolleys transport components to workstations and finished goods to dispatch areas, maintaining the rhythm that keeps productivity high.
Healthcare And Hospitality Sectors
Hospitals use trolleys for everything from meals to medical supplies. Hotels rely on them for housekeeping, room service, and conference setups. Clean, quiet-wheeled trolleys suit these customer-facing environments perfectly.
